The Oregon Clinic is the largest private specialty physician practice in Oregon. More than 300 physicians and advanced practice practitioners provide respectful, compassionate care in more than 30 specialty areas, resulting in more than 550,000 patient visits each year. Founded in Portland in 1994, The Oregon Clinic is committed to delivering the highest quality patient care, practicing evidence-based medicine, and providing leadership for the healthcare community. We collaborate with primary care physicians and use a team approach to address health conditions at almost 60 specialty clinic locations across northwest Oregon and southwest Washington.
